Provide special education consultation and instruction to meet the needs of eligible students identified with autism spectrum disorder. This role involves participating in ARD/IEP meetings, completing required paperwork, developing and implementing instructional programs, demonstrating competence in behavior management principles, administering testing, communicating with parents and staff, collecting data on student progress, and providing instruction using research-based methods. The teacher will also participate in professional development, physically prompt students, and may have additional SHARS duties and provide personal care as identified in IEPs.
